    Had seen something similar in my vx5 but never really looked closely. Had a closer look today and have the Hairy Duplex feature too. Not just the finer inner part, but also the thicker outer part of the reticle.

    Also a spec inside (upper right quadrant) which is visible at low mag (~3x-7x). Doesn’t affect function obviously but mildly distracting and annoying. Had just agreed on a price to sell to a mate, but don’t feel right moving the problem on. Will be talking to NZAsia tomorrow.
